Fiber-optic sensors are optical sensors based on fiber devices. They are often used for sensing temperature and/or mechanical stress.
For instance, some of the most common uses for fiber optic sensors is within oil & gas, pipeline, electric utility, structural health monitoring, and telecom cable applications.
